Ex-Man City left-back Mendy signs for FC Zurich
Briefly

Benjamin Mendy, the World Cup-winning defender, has signed with Swiss club FC Zürich on a contract lasting until the end of the next season. The 30-year-old previously played for French club Lorient but had not made any appearances this season. Mendy, who gained fame with Manchester City, where he secured three Premier League titles, had been sidelined since August 2021 while facing legal issues but was later acquitted. FC Zürich currently sits eighth in the Swiss league, posing opportunities for Mendy to revitalize his career.
